Abstract The objective of this research is to investigate the performances of the carbon­

basalt/epoxy hybrid composites under flexural loading. In this work, the hybrid composites 

were manufactured by the vacuum assisted resin transfer molding (VARTM) process. The 

variations of flexural strength and modulus of the hybrid composite according to the number 

of basalt fabric were investigated, and we obtained the expression to calculate their 

mechanical properties. In the study of flexural properties for the hybrid composites with
